How is this tuning method accurate?
several reasons...
there should be a constant drop across the cat which can be calibrated.
cats only work at stoich, tuning is not going on under stoich conditions.
the tail pipe is an estimate.

Recently during tuning.. I compared values from my LC-1 mounted in the downpipe, and my tuners Autronic exhaust gas analyzer mounted in the tail pipe. My exhaust is 3" AMS downpippe and RC Dev 3" decat and cat back.
The LC-1 read about .3 AFR lean at idle... and then about .3 AFR rich at full boost (compared to what the Autronic read). If you don't have any leaks in your exhaust... I'd really like someone to explain how the tail pipe mounting is less accurate?
Based on the above results if I ever use the LC-1 for tuning I will deffo be on the safe side in terms of fueling.
Some of the most expensive analyzers like Autronic come with kits for mounting in the muffler. If it was not appropriate they wouldn't sell with the clamps and such.
As for delay, yes I'd agree it probably is slightly slower... by whatever the time the exhaust gas takes to travel 10 feet or so... which I'd doubt is very long.
